"Good" and "cheap" are two words that seldom go good together. Especially with arrows. The arrow is your connecting link between you and your target...not the thing you want to go cheap quality on.
Your best bet is to find used but good quality arrows on ArcheryTalk that are cheaper priced. I like to find them that are longer than what I need so that I can cut off any impact cracks that may be present on them. I got a dozen and a half of Easton N-Fused Axis shafts for $75 shipped tmd. They normally are around $130 a dozen new. There are deals like that on there every day...just need to know how long of shafts you need and what spine you need them in.
